Question / Help rtmp server sent an invalid ssl certificate

zstreich

New Member
I just noticed today that Facebook just updated it's rtmp parameters on May 1. Now the secure connection (SSL) button is locked. And when I try to stream, there is an error code that says, "rtmp server sent an invalid ssl certificate". I log notes are below. Anyway to solve this issue?

13:00:36.635: ---------------------------------
13:00:36.635: video settings reset:
13:00:36.635: base resolution: 1920x1080
13:00:36.635: output resolution: 1920x1080
13:00:36.635: downscale filter: Bilinear
13:00:36.635: fps: 30/1
13:00:36.635: format: NV12
13:00:36.635: YUV mode: 601/Partial
13:00:36.635: NV12 texture support not available
13:00:36.635: Audio monitoring device:
13:00:36.635: name: Blackmagic Web Presenter
13:00:36.635: id: AppleUSBAudioEngine:Blackmagic Design:Blackmagic Web Presenter:26543046151515022631:3
13:00:36.635: ---------------------------------
13:00:36.643: Failed to load 'en-US' text for module: 'decklink-ouput-ui.so'
13:00:36.653: os_dlopen(libpython3.6m.dylib->libpython3.6m.dylib): dlopen(libpython3.6m.dylib, 1): image not found
13:00:36.653:
13:00:36.653: [Python] Could not load library: libpython3.6m.dylib
13:00:36.724: No blackmagic support
13:00:36.807: [VideoToolbox encoder]: Adding VideoToolbox H264 encoders
13:00:36.844: [obs-browser]: Version 2.3.1
13:00:36.876: os_dlopen(/Applications/VLC.app/Contents/MacOS/lib/libvlccore.dylib->/Applications/VLC.app/Contents/MacOS/lib/libvlccore.dylib): dlopen(/Applications/VLC.app/Contents/MacOS/lib/libvlccore.dylib, 1): image not found
13:00:36.876:
13:00:36.876: Couldn't find VLC installation, VLC video source disabled
13:00:36.876: Ignoring old obs-browser.so version
13:00:36.876: ---------------------------------
13:00:36.876: Loaded Modules:
13:00:36.876: vlc-video.so
13:00:36.876: text-freetype2.so
13:00:36.876: rtmp-services.so
13:00:36.876: obs-x264.so
13:00:36.876: obs-vst.so
13:00:36.876: obs-transitions.so
13:00:36.876: obs-outputs.so
13:00:36.876: obs-filters.so
13:00:36.877: obs-ffmpeg.so
13:00:36.877: obs-browser.so
13:00:36.877: mac-vth264.so
13:00:36.877: mac-syphon.so
13:00:36.877: mac-decklink.so
13:00:36.877: mac-capture.so
13:00:36.877: mac-avcapture.so
13:00:36.877: linux-jack.so
13:00:36.877: image-source.so
13:00:36.877: frontend-tools.so
13:00:36.877: decklink-ouput-ui.so
13:00:36.877: coreaudio-encoder.so
13:00:36.877: ---------------------------------
13:00:36.877: ==== Startup complete ===============================================
13:00:37.099: All scene data cleared
13:00:37.099: ------------------------------------------------
13:00:37.131: coreaudio: device 'Blackmagic Web Presenter' initialized
13:00:39.510: coreaudio: device 'Blackmagic Web Presenter' initialized
13:00:39.514: coreaudio: device 'Blackmagic Web Presenter' initialized
13:00:39.525: audio_monitor_init: start failed: -66637
13:00:39.531: Video Capture Device: Selected device 'Blackmagic Web Presenter'
13:00:39.533: Video Capture Device: Using preset 1280x720
13:00:39.543: adding 23 milliseconds of audio buffering, total audio buffering is now 23 milliseconds (source: Mic/Aux 2)
13:00:39.543:
13:00:39.689: adding 23 milliseconds of audio buffering, total audio buffering is now 46 milliseconds (source: Mic/Aux 2)
13:00:39.689:
13:00:44.682: [Media Source 'Media Source']: settings:
13:00:44.682: input: /Users/cmoreno/Downloads/10 Second Timer.mp4
13:00:44.682: input_format: (null)
13:00:44.682: speed: 100
13:00:44.682: is_looping: no
13:00:44.682: is_hw_decoding: no
13:00:44.682: is_clear_on_media_end: no
13:00:44.682: restart_on_activate: yes
13:00:44.682: close_when_inactive: no
13:00:44.682: MP: Failed to open media: '/Users/cmoreno/Downloads/10 Second Timer.mp4'
13:00:44.685: Switched to scene 'Camera'
13:00:44.685: ------------------------------------------------
13:00:44.685: Loaded scenes:
13:00:44.685: - scene 'Clip':
13:00:44.685: - source: 'Media Source' (ffmpeg_source)
13:00:44.685: - scene 'Camera':
13:00:44.685: - source: 'Video Capture Device' (av_capture_input)
13:00:44.685: - scene 'Scene 2':
13:00:44.685: ------------------------------------------------
13:01:47.447: Settings changed (stream 1)
13:01:47.448: ------------------------------------------------
13:01:48.352: ---------------------------------
13:01:48.352: [x264 encoder: 'streaming_h264'] preset: veryfast
13:01:48.352: [x264 encoder: 'streaming_h264'] profile: main
13:01:48.354: [x264 encoder: 'streaming_h264'] settings:
13:01:48.354: rate_control: CBR
13:01:48.354: bitrate: 3000
13:01:48.354: buffer size: 3000
13:01:48.354: crf: 0
13:01:48.354: fps_num: 30
13:01:48.354: fps_den: 1
13:01:48.354: width: 1280
13:01:48.354: height: 720
13:01:48.354: keyint: 60
13:01:48.354:
13:01:48.362: [CoreAudio AAC: 'Track1']: settings:
13:01:48.362: mode: AAC
13:01:48.362: bitrate: 128
13:01:48.362: sample rate: 44100
13:01:48.362: cbr: on
13:01:48.362: output buffer: 1536
13:01:48.362: [rtmp stream: 'adv_stream'] Connecting to RTMP URL rtmps://rtmp-api.facebook.com:443/rtmp/...
13:01:48.468: RTMP_Connect1, Cert verify failed: 8 (The certificate is not correctly signed by the trusted CA)
13:01:48.469: [rtmp stream: 'adv_stream'] Connection to rtmps://rtmp-api.facebook.com:443/rtmp/ failed: -2
13:01:48.469: ==== Streaming Stop ================================================
13:03:21.039: Settings changed (stream 1)
 

Attachments

  • Screen Shot 2019-05-02 at 1.29.02 PM.png
    Screen Shot 2019-05-02 at 1.29.02 PM.png
    54.6 KB · Views: 240

Roy Roy

New Member
I'm having the same problem with Facebook Livestreamings on Windows 7, getting the same error message. Someone please solve this issue. I tried using custom server, it didn't work.
 

c3r1c3

Member
That error message means that Facebook is using bad certs. That means Facebook needs to start issuing correctly formed certs, and that RTMPS won't work until then.

If you can stream using RTMP instead of RTMPS that should work...but from what I recall Facebook is not allowing RTMP streams anymore (or at least is starting to shutdown support for them).

Have either of you contacted Facebook to let them know of this issue?
 
Top